Testing the construct validity of the PICTS proactive and reactive scores against six putative measures of proactive and reactive criminal thinking
This study tested the construct validity of the Psychological Inventory of Criminal Thinking Styles (PICTS) Proactive (P) and Reactive (R) scores. The layperson version of the PICTS was administered to 277 (65 male, 212 female) undergraduates and correlated with putative measures of proactive and re...
